Description

The AACi 53026 is a semiconductor contactor designed for power connection/disconnection in DC circuits, serving as a lightweight and compact alternative to mechanical contactors. It features a built-in antispark circuit that prevents sparking when connecting capacitive loads to power supplies. The device supports both one-way and bidirectional operation with 530A continuous current rating, 1000A peak current, and operates at 12-26V nominal voltage. It includes CAN bus and RS485 communication interfaces for control and diagnostics, and operates in automatic or semi-automatic modes.
